Jobs
Interviews

2 Ios Xcode Jobs

Setup a job Alert
JobPe aggregates results for easy application access, but you actually apply on the job portal directly.

3.0 - 5.0 years

0 Lacs

gurugram, haryana, india

On-site

Role - Senior Frontend Developer [React Native], AI Healthcare startup Experience: 3+ years Location: Gurgaon, work from office About Tap Health: Tap Health is a deep tech startup that helps people manage chronic conditions between doctor visits with AI-first, mobile-first digital therapeutics. Our flagship, fully autonomous diabetes digital therapeutic makes daily disease management effortless, delivering real-time, human-level guidance tailored to each users habits, psychology, and health data. By combining predictive AI, behavioural science and vernacular design, we are creating care products that are radically more scalable and easier to follow than legacy models. We are reimagining chronic care to fit how people live www.tap.health Role Overview: Senior Frontend Developer As a Frontend Developer at Tap Health, youll build and maintain our cross-platform mobile applications using React Native. Youll work closely with design, product, and backend teams to deliver high-quality, performant, and user-friendly experiences on both iOS and Android. Key Responsibilities Feature Development: D evelopment of high-performance, scalable React Native applications for iOS and Android. Code Maintenance: Triage bugs, refactor legacy code, and ensure codebase health and consistency. Performance Optimization: Profile and tune app performance (load times, animations, memory usage) for a smooth UX. Integration: Connect frontend components with RESTful APIs, GraphQL endpoints, and third-party SDKs. Testing & QA: Write and maintain unit, integration, and UI tests (e.g. Jest, Detox) to ensure stability. Collaboration: Participate in sprint planning, code reviews, and pair-programming sessions with cross-functional peers. CI/CD Support: Help maintain automated build, test, and deployment pipelines for mobile releases. Skills & Experience 1-3 years of frontend/mobile development experiencebuilding production apps with React Native Strong familiarity with iOS (Xcode) and Android (Android Studio) toolchains Proficient in JavaScript/TypeScript , modern React practices, and state-management libraries (Redux, Context API, etc.) Experience integrating with RESTful APIs , GraphQL , and handling offline-first data Solid understanding of mobile performance optimization and memory management Comfortable with Git workflows and branching strategies Hands-on with automated testing tools (Jest, Detox, Appium, etc.) Knowledge of CI/CD pipelines for mobile (fastlane, Bitrise, GitHub Actions, etc.) Strong UI/UX sensibility and attention to detail Familiarity with Agile methodologies (Scrum/Kanban) Show more Show less

Posted 2 weeks ago

Apply

2.0 - 6.0 years

0 Lacs

karnataka

On-site

You are ready to acquire the skills and experience necessary to progress in your current role and propel your career to new heights, and an exciting software engineering opportunity awaits you. In this role, you will: - Execute standard software solutions by designing, developing, and troubleshooting technically. You will write secure and high-quality code independently, using the syntax of at least one programming language. - Design, code, and troubleshoot while considering upstream and downstream systems and technical implications. You will apply your knowledge of tools in the Software Development Life Cycle to enhance automation value. - Utilize technical troubleshooting skills to dissect solutions and resolve technical issues of basic complexity. You will analyze large data sets to identify problems and contribute to decision-making for secure and stable application development. - Learn and implement system processes, methodologies, and skills to develop secure and stable code and systems. Furthermore, you will contribute to fostering a team culture of diversity, equity, inclusion, and respect. To be successful in this role, you must have: - Formal training or certification in software engineering concepts along with at least 2 years of practical experience in system design, application development, testing, and operational stability. - Hands-on experience in Mobile Browser and Mobile Native Application Testing, including the use of Mobile Cloud Platform tools like SeeTest. Proficiency in mobile development and emulator packages such as Android SDK, iOS XCode, SWIFT, Calabash, Appium, GENYmotion is essential. - Exposure to commercial mobile manual/automation test management packages like Perfecto, Experitest-SeeTest, MobileLabs, SauceLabs, etc. Experience in Accessibility and Analytics Testing for Web and Mobile Native Apps is a plus. - Proficiency in managing the development Test Scenarios and executing them across various Testing Phases. A solid understanding of the Software Development Life Cycle and agile methodologies like CI/CD, Application Resiliency, and Security is required. - Demonstrated knowledge of software applications and technical processes within a technical discipline, such as cloud, artificial intelligence, machine learning, or mobile technologies. Preferred qualifications include: - Strong understanding of Android development, including Android Studio and Kotlin. Experience in releasing applications on the Google Play Store and familiarity with pair programming. If you are eager to enhance your software engineering skills and contribute to a dynamic team environment, this opportunity is tailored for you.,

Posted 1 month ago

Apply
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

Featured Companies